Pedro Pascal jokes his insanely strong coffee order being revealed to the internet was ‘violating’
- Last year, photos of *The Last of Us* star Pedro Pascal holding a cup of coffee revealing his order of six espresso shots went viral.
- Pascal considered his morning coffee ritual, which involved a mega-shot of caffeine to help with productivity, to be incredibly private.
- On a recent episode of *Jimmy Kimmel Live!*, Pascal jokingly expressed his displeasure at having his coffee order exposed, stating that it felt violating.
- Pascal explained that his coffee order evolved from a quad shot to six shots because he felt the cups got bigger and the shots got less strong, leading him to say, "I cannot begin to tell you how violating this was."
- Pascal, who is also set to return in HBO's *The Last of Us* on April 13 and is tapped to play Mr. Fantastic in the upcoming *Fantastic 4* reboot and *Avengers: Doomsday*, joked that drinking his coffee makes him "really high" and helps him answer emails.
